Video: Kam tiek izmantota kaudzes šķirošana?
2024 Autors: Lynn Donovan | [email protected]. Pēdējoreiz modificēts: 2023-12-15 23:50
The Kaudzes kārtošana algoritms ir plaši izplatīts lietots tās efektivitātes dēļ. Kaudzes kārtošana darbojas, pārveidojot vienumu sarakstu par sakārtoti uz a kaudze datu struktūra, binārs koks ar kaudze īpašības. Binārajā kokā katram mezglam ir ne vairāk kā divi pēcnācēji.
Tātad, kāpēc mēs izmantojam kaudzes kārtošanu?
Heapsort algoritms ir ierobežots lietojumiem jo Quicksort ir labāk praksē. Kaudze Ieviestās prioritārās rindas ir lietots Graph algoritmos, piemēram, Prima algoritmā un Dijkstras algoritmā. Pasūtījumu statistika: Kaudze datu struktūra var būt lietots lai efektīvi atrastu k-to mazāko (vai lielāko) elementu anarray.
Papildus iepriekš minētajam, kā darbojas kaudzes kārtošana? The kaudze šķirot Algoritmu var iedalīt divās daļās. Otrajā solī a sakārtoti masīvs tiek izveidots, atkārtoti noņemot lielāko elementu no kaudze (sakne no kaudze ) un ievietojot to masīvā. The kaudze tiek atjaunināts pēc katras noņemšanas, lai saglabātu kaudze īpašums. Heapsort var veikt uz vietas.
Pēc tam rodas jautājums, kāds ir kaudzes mērķis?
Dažās programmēšanas valodās, tostarp C un Pascal, a kaudze ir iepriekš rezervētas datora galvenās krātuves (atmiņas) apgabals, ko programmas process var izmantot, lai saglabātu datus mainīgā apjomā, kas nebūs zināms, kamēr programma nedarbosies.
Kas ir kaudzes kārtošana un tās algoritms?
Kaudzes kārtošanas algoritms . Kaudzes kārtošana ir populārs un efektīvs šķirošanas algoritms datorprogrammēšanā. Kaudzes kārtošana darbojas, vizualizējot masīva elementus kā īpaša veida pilnīgu bināro koku, ko sauc kaudze.
Ieteicams:
Kam tiek izmantota datoranimācija?
Datoranimācija ir kustīgu attēlu radīšanas māksla, izmantojot datorus. Tā ir datorgrafikas un animācijas apakšlauks. Arvien biežāk tā tiek veidota, izmantojot 3D datorgrafiku, lai gan 2D datorgrafika joprojām tiek plaši izmantota zema joslas platuma un ātrākas reāllaika renderēšanas vajadzībām
Kam tiek izmantota klasteru skaitļošana?
Datoru kopas tiek izmantotas skaitļošanas ietilpīgiem mērķiem, nevis uz IO orientētu darbību, piemēram, tīmekļa pakalpojumu vai datu bāzu, apstrādei. Piemēram, datoru klasteris var atbalstīt transportlīdzekļu avāriju vai laikapstākļu skaitļošanas simulācijas
Kam tiek izmantota datu plūsma?
Google Cloud Dataflow ir mākoņdatošanas datu apstrādes pakalpojums gan pakešu, gan reāllaika datu straumēšanas lietojumprogrammām. Tas ļauj izstrādātājiem iestatīt apstrādes cauruļvadus, lai integrētu, sagatavotu un analizētu lielas datu kopas, piemēram, tās, kas atrodamas Web analytics vai lielo datu analīzes lietojumprogrammās
Kam tiek izmantota persona?
Personas ir izdomāti varoņi, kurus izveidojat, pamatojoties uz savu pētījumu, lai attēlotu dažādus lietotāju veidus, kuri varētu izmantot jūsu pakalpojumu, produktu, vietni vai zīmolu līdzīgā veidā. Personu izveide palīdzēs izprast lietotāju vajadzības, pieredzi, uzvedību un mērķus
Kam tiek izmantota maršrutētāja iegremdēšanas pamatne?
Iegremdējamās pamatnes frēzes parasti ir labākas iekšējiem griezumiem. Tie bieži tiek uzskatīti par vislabākajiem iesācējiem vai jauniem galdniekiem, jo tos ir vieglāk uzstādīt un apstrādāt. Šis maršrutētāja veids ir populārs dziļu rievu griešanai biezā kokā. Tos bieži izmanto veidņu darbam, zīmju veidošanai un gravēšanai